
Safe Tractor and Machinery Operation Program (STOMP)
The Safe Tractor and Machinery Operation Program (STOMP) is a training initiative designed to teach operators how to work safely and effectively with tractors and farm machinery. It covers essential skills such as proper equipment handling, maintenance, safety protocols, and hazard awareness to prevent accidents. STOMP aims to promote a culture of safety, reduce injuries, and ensure that equipment is used responsibly. It’s typically used in agricultural settings to prepare individuals for responsible machinery operation, emphasizing both safety and efficiency in farm work.
